> I would like to order the before commit hooks on a transaction by being
> able to specify an order for a subscriber at registration time. For the
> moment, they are called in the order they've been registred.
>
> The order argument could be an integer with a default value to 0 added
> to the registration method.
>
> We could just insert the subscriber wihin the queue according to this
> order parameter if found *or* sorting the queue according to this
> parameter before flushing the queue and calling the hooks.
>
> What do you think ?
What is the motivation for this? Can you give any use cases?
I'm -1 on this because it adds complexity to something that I think
should be simple. It feels like something that is likely to be
missused. I do have an open mind though.
